DK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2024 in Review

226 of the 6,924 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Delek US (DK) for Q2 2024, worth a combined $1.59B — down 21% from $2.01B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 43 funds opened new DK positions and 34 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 67 added to existing stakes and 85 trimmed.

The largest buyer was ExodusPoint Capital Management, adding an estimated $30.9M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$28M.
